Perplexity: “The controversy involving Scarlett Johansson and OpenAI’s ChatGPT voice centers around the introduction of a new AI voice assistant named “Sky,” which many users and industry professionals noted bore a striking resemblance to Johansson’s voice from the 2013 film “Her.” Johansson voiced an AI assistant in the film, and the similarity between her voice and Sky’s led to significant backlash.”
